The Youth Program at Unity of New York welcomes all children to Sunday classes at Symphony Space. Our doors open at 10:30am and classes are finished by the end of the adult service. Pre-school and Elementary classes are held downstairs in Symphony Space’s rehearsal studio. Uniteens and Y.O.U meet on the main floor in the West Gallery.
Pre-school – ages 3-5
Elementary – ages 6-10
Uniteens – ages 11-13
Y.O.U. – ages 14+
Curriculum:
In our Youth Program we follow Unity’s Living Curriculum, which offers hands-on experiences that draw forth the Truth principles that already reside within each child through storytelling, discussion, creative experiences, affirmations, meditation, prayer and song.
Myrtle Fillmore, co-founder of Unity, believed that our mission is not to “entertain the children, but to draw them out.”
Each month’s lessons and activities are drawn from Unity approved curriculum and materials, the Children’s Illustrated Bible, and other inspiring stories. The lessons are arranged by monthly themes for each respective age group.
For the Uniteens and Y.O.U., the Living Curriculum serves to empower the youth to use spiritual wisdom to fulfill their souls’ purpose and actively supports the students in their unfolding as well as assisting them in developing skill at living spiritual principles.
Unity kids are also involved in volunteer outreach activities throughout the year. Our Uniteens and Y.O.U. kids will be participating for the first time this year in the regional retreats, where they’ll have the opportunity to meet other Uniteens and Y.O.U. kids from other Unity churches and share and learn more about spiritual principles.
